excel怎么统计出现次数

excel怎么统计出现次数

在Excel中统计出现次数有多种方法,包括使用COUNTIF函数、透视表、数据透视表和其他工具。 其中,COUNTIF函数是最常用的方法,因为它简洁且易于使用。下面我们将详细介绍如何使用COUNTIF函数来统计出现次数,并逐步讲解其他方法如透视表和数据透视表等。

一、使用COUNTIF函数统计出现次数

1. COUNTIF函数的基本用法

COUNTIF函数是一个非常强大的工具,用于统计满足特定条件的单元格数量。其语法为:

COUNTIF(range, criteria)

  • range: 要统计的单元格范围。
  • criteria: 统计的条件,可以是数字、表达式、单元格引用或文本。

例如,要统计A列中值为“苹果”的单元格数量,可以使用以下公式:

=COUNTIF(A:A, "苹果")

2. 使用COUNTIF统计多个条件

如果需要统计多个条件,可以使用COUNTIFS函数。其语法为:

COUNTIFS(criteria_range1, criteria1, [criteria_range2, criteria2], …)

例如,要统计A列中值为“苹果”且B列中值为“红色”的单元格数量,可以使用以下公式:

=COUNTIFS(A:A, "苹果", B:B, "红色")

3. COUNTIF函数的实际应用示例

假设我们有一张包含水果种类和颜色的表格,我们可以通过COUNTIF函数统计每种水果的出现次数:

水果     颜色

苹果 红色

香蕉 黄色

苹果 绿色

橙子 橙色

苹果 红色

在C列输入以下公式,可以统计每种水果的出现次数:

=COUNTIF(A:A, A2)

将公式向下拖动,即可统计所有水果的出现次数。

二、使用透视表统计出现次数

1. 创建透视表

透视表是一种强大的数据分析工具,可以快速总结、分析、探索和展示数据。以下是创建透视表的步骤:

  1. 选择数据范围。
  2. 点击菜单栏中的“插入”,选择“透视表”。
  3. 在弹出的窗口中,选择透视表的放置位置(新工作表或现有工作表)。
  4. 点击“确定”。

2. 配置透视表字段

在右侧的“透视表字段”区域,拖动需要统计的字段到“行标签”或“列标签”,将需要统计的字段拖动到“值”区域。

例如,统计水果种类的出现次数:

  1. 将“水果”字段拖动到“行标签”。
  2. 将“水果”字段拖动到“值”区域(系统会自动选择计数)。

透视表会自动生成每种水果的出现次数。

三、使用数据透视表统计出现次数

1. 数据透视表的优势

数据透视表提供了更灵活的数据分析和可视化选项,可以方便地分组、过滤和计算数据。以下是创建数据透视表的步骤:

  1. 选择数据范围。
  2. 点击菜单栏中的“数据”,选择“数据透视表”。
  3. 在弹出的窗口中,选择数据透视表的放置位置(新工作表或现有工作表)。
  4. 点击“确定”。

2. 配置数据透视表字段

在右侧的“数据透视表字段”区域,拖动需要统计的字段到“行标签”或“列标签”,将需要统计的字段拖动到“值”区域。

例如,统计水果种类的出现次数:

  1. 将“水果”字段拖动到“行标签”。
  2. 将“水果”字段拖动到“值”区域(系统会自动选择计数)。

数据透视表会自动生成每种水果的出现次数。

四、使用其他工具统计出现次数

1. 使用COUNT函数和IF函数结合

COUNT函数可以统计特定范围内满足条件的单元格数量,可以与IF函数结合使用,实现更复杂的条件统计。其语法为:

=COUNT(IF(criteria_range = criteria, range))

例如,统计A列中值为“苹果”的单元格数量,可以使用以下公式:

=COUNT(IF(A:A = "苹果", A:A))

注意:此公式需要按Ctrl+Shift+Enter键,以数组公式的形式输入。

2. 使用SUMPRODUCT函数统计出现次数

SUMPRODUCT函数可以计算数组的乘积和,可以用于统计多个条件的出现次数。其语法为:

=SUMPRODUCT((criteria_range1 = criteria1) * (criteria_range2 = criteria2) * range)

例如,统计A列中值为“苹果”且B列中值为“红色”的单元格数量,可以使用以下公式:

=SUMPRODUCT((A:A = "苹果") * (B:B = "红色"))

五、总结

在Excel中统计出现次数的方法多种多样,主要包括COUNTIF函数、透视表、数据透视表、以及其他函数如SUMPRODUCT。其中,COUNTIF函数因其简便和直观,适用于大多数场景。透视表和数据透视表则提供了更强大的数据分析和可视化功能,适用于更复杂的数据分析任务。

通过熟练掌握这些方法,您可以在工作中更加高效地处理和分析数据,提高工作效率和数据分析能力。希望这篇文章能对您有所帮助,进一步提升您的Excel技能。

相关问答FAQs:

1. 如何在Excel中统计某个单元格中特定数值出现的次数?

  • 首先,选中你想要统计出现次数的单元格范围。
  • 其次,点击Excel菜单栏中的“数据”选项卡。
  • 接下来,选择“排序和筛选”功能下的“高级”选项。
  • 在弹出的对话框中,将选择“复制到其他位置”并勾选“只显示唯一值”选项。
  • 然后,在“复制到”输入框中选择一个空白单元格作为输出结果的位置。
  • 最后,点击“确定”按钮,Excel将会在你选择的输出单元格中显示特定数值的出现次数。

2. 如何在Excel中统计某个单元格范围内不同数值的个数?

  • 首先,选中你想要统计不同数值个数的单元格范围。
  • 其次,点击Excel菜单栏中的“数据”选项卡。
  • 接下来,选择“排序和筛选”功能下的“高级”选项。
  • 在弹出的对话框中,将选择“复制到其他位置”并勾选“只显示唯一值”选项。
  • 然后,在“复制到”输入框中选择一个空白单元格作为输出结果的位置。
  • 最后,点击“确定”按钮,Excel将会在你选择的输出单元格中显示不同数值的个数。

3. 如何在Excel中统计某个单元格范围内特定文本出现的次数?

  • 首先,选中你想要统计特定文本出现次数的单元格范围。
  • 其次,点击Excel菜单栏中的“开始”选项卡。
  • 接下来,在“编辑”功能组中点击“查找和选择”按钮,然后选择“查找”选项。
  • 在弹出的查找对话框中,输入你想要统计的特定文本。
  • 然后,点击“查找全部”按钮,Excel将会列出所有匹配的单元格。
  • 最后,根据列表中匹配单元格的数量,即可得到特定文本出现的次数。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/3949693

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部